Transaction 8c1931e493a002a637b7ddd25a08c9e2e3d2726fc77c16eefc0c284324b2c2c8

50 Input
1 Outputs
  • 8c1931e493a002a637b7ddd25a08c9e2e3d2726fc77c16eefc0c284324b2c2c8:0
  • value  4443542
    address  3HSThQAr54wJfxUBhzvKpxwSX5r6vrJXWJ